The Central Weather Bureau lifted the '0608 Heavy Rain Event' at 8:00 AM on June 10. Meteorologist Wu Derong warned that a stationary front will continue to linger near Taiwan, bringing prolonged rainfall and a threat of severe weather through mid-June.
